Post-election backing provides relief to Rep. DeWitt

By JIM BUTLER

Jason DeWitt’s campaign received enough contributions after his election as District 25 state representative to repay him a $50,000 loan he made to get it started.

DeWitt, of Boyce, was elected in the October 14 primary.

According to its report filed this month, the freshman legislator’s campaign fund received $12,500 in contributions between October 30 and December 31, including $5,000 from the Republican Legislative Delegation and $2,500 from La Realtors PAC.

The campaign was able to pay back the loan on December 13. It had $47,000 on hand at the start of the period.

After paying the debt and miscellaneous other expenses, the fund entered 2024 with about $8,000 on hand.

DeWitt has been appointed to the House Appropriations, Labor and Industrial Relations, and Natural Resources and Environment committees and the Joint Legislative Committee on the Budget.
